Transaction ebda930abb0b37adc0d5f32f81482ff36858c7ba908d7677d89095509a32809e

1 Input
2 Outputs
  • ebda930abb0b37adc0d5f32f81482ff36858c7ba908d7677d89095509a32809e:0
  • value  44759575
    address  1CFpa8PsK1Zduj7K6CDRjqrwLmoWrYEpbi
  • ebda930abb0b37adc0d5f32f81482ff36858c7ba908d7677d89095509a32809e:1
  • value  1955210425
    address  14QQqAonKazNw6Q2ykJ1xVXPMmhoVRqEBu